The digi-microscope has a wide range of professional and academic uses. In biomedical labs, it is used to analyze cell morphology and identify abnormalities. Industrial scientists rely on the digi-microscope in testing product consistency, micro defect detection, and surface characterization. In agriculture, it is used to study plant diseases, seed morphology, and pest interactions. Museums and conservation centers apply the digi-microscope in analyzing artwork materials to ensure proper preservation and restoration of historical works.

Cleaning, checking, and storing the digi-microscope with care is part of taking care of them. Dust accumulation can impact both optical and mechanical performance, and thus covering the digi-microscope when idle is inevitable. Avoid handling objective lenses with unmasked fingers to prevent oil smudges and residues. Remove immersion oil instantly after observation. The digi-microscope are kept in a controlled, temperature-stable environment. Periodic focus and illumination system calibration ensures image quality in the long term.

Q: What are the main parts of a microscope? A: The key components include the eyepiece, objective lenses, stage, focusing knobs, and illumination system, all working together to magnify and clarify specimens. Q: How do you clean the lenses of a microscope? A: Lenses should be cleaned using soft lens paper or microfiber cloth with a small amount of lens cleaner to avoid scratching or damaging optical coatings. Q: What magnification levels can a microscope achieve? A: Depending on the model, a microscope can typically achieve magnifications ranging from 40x to over 1000x for detailed observation of microscopic structures. Q: Why is light adjustment important in a microscope? A: Proper light adjustment ensures accurate contrast and brightness, allowing clear observation without distortion or glare during viewing. Q: Can a microscope be used for educational purposes? A: Yes, microscopes are widely used in classrooms and laboratories to teach students about biology, materials science, and microscopic analysis.
